Electra Protocol Blockchain, Multi Layer Explorer
Supply: 18,337,366,077 Lastest Block: 1,983,682 Utxos: 1,984,829
Nodes: 386 OmniXEP Contracts: 278
Address balances
xP6MTr8fBz4jrTUy7k3Xm7GybnyxAF3tS9
XEPElectra Protocol [XEP]
Balance
0.000875
No omnixep tokens